UF cornerback Brown talks Tide
Keith Niebuhr
InsidetheGators.com For two years, Florida cornerback Jeremy Brown was sidelined by lingering back problems. This season, Brown finally is healthy and he is playing at a high level. The sophomore already has three interceptions, including one that he returned for six. This week, Brown faces his toughest test -- No. 1 Alabama on the road
Here's what he thinks
About facing standout Alabama receiver Julio Jones: "He's almost a perfect receiver. He's physical, tall, big
so it's something that we're really going to have to focus on -- stopping him."
About covering a bigger receiver (Jones is 6-foot-4, 220 pounds): "Similar to Kentucky. You just break down film, use technique and be pretty successful.
You've got to go through them."
